On Pursuit of Jade Mar 13, 2026
Title Pursuit of Jade Spoiler
Now for the depiction of war, last time I felt this way was when I watched My Dearest. That show and this show know what they are doing - focusing on the horrors that normal people face, not on the fancy battles of the armies.

I loved how long the attack on the village lasted, how much detail we've got, how there was no censoring how truly awful it is. People getting slaughtered, keeping no one alive. This is the horror of the war. Not hot generals doing backflips on the battlefield.

We've got to know the supporting characters so now that they faced such a horrifying death it hits us more. This is why the proper set up, taking your time to establish the world the characters live in, to develop the characters leads interact with is so important - it adds emotional weight.

I also love how consistent the writing is and how past actions, even if small, have bigger consequences later. For example: Granny Kang and her death. Initially she was introduced as a small villain in female lead's life - one that spread rumors and was always nasty towards Chang Yu. And then we had that one scene in which Chang Yu could make two choices - show kindness or seek "revenge". She chose kindness and invited Granny Kang in for Xie Zheng to write her wishes. During the attack scene she first risked her life to hide Changning and then sacrificed herself to keep the kids safe. One act of kindness led to change that eventually saved Changning. I know it's not as simplistic, but I love the progression of that storyline so much.

Similarly the daughter of the minister - yes she did not want to tell anything to Yuanqing because he killed her parents, but she could still want to harm Chang Yu if she was truly evil. But she saw how Chang Yu is in fact a good person, she did not want to harm her in the process. The way she articulated that "I don't know" was honestly so brave and strong. The way she lied in a way to make sure he knew and understood she was lying and she did not want to tell him the truth.

I love how faced with danger and life or death situation it truly shows who the people are. Just because someone is spoiled, or ignorant, or at times acts with full on pity party, does not mean they are bad people at heart. These small meaningless disagreements do not matter in situations like that. Are you selfish or selfless. Would you let someone else die to safe yourself? We witnessed both cases in the drama.

And then as a sidenote - can we talk about how well this drama uses light and undertones for scenes? When Chang Yu goes to the town and is faced with the death of all the people she knew and cared about, how cold the undertones are, how everything is in that blue hue. And then when Madame Zhao shows up with some survivors, how the sun comes out, and everything starts to have this warm orange hue, how them surviving literally brings back home and warmth to FLs life. Qian Qian and Qi Min - thoughts after episode 19
On Pursuit of Jade Mar 13, 2026
Title Pursuit of Jade Spoiler
We were long enough in delulu hoping they would be toxic in the "traditional" way, but no. This is just toxic. And I appreciate that. Now that I finished episode 19, I appreciate how they are not really romanticizing ANY of the "toxic" relationships. Let's chat.

At first they might have food us. Right at the beginning of the drama Yu Qian Qian did seem more angry and fearful when reminded of Qi Min. They also did a good job to give a toxic passionate vibes from their first meeting - the hands touching in slow motion, the way he looked at her, the fact she did not yet seem scared. But the pretty picture shattered quickly.

The more episodes I saw, the more clear it became that this is a horror story, not love story. It's not toxic angry exes meeting again and playing push and pull game. This is one man beating a woman down to submission. It's gross. And scary. And sad.

The scene where he first threatened her with loves of the servants and then his own son? Made me feel sick. But the directing was so good in it. Literally 1.5 second shot, but they made sure everything during this scene conveys how awful it was. How tragic sad and horrifying, that even the maids were holding back tears. That one shot from the maid was just everything. Because it conveyed how this moment looks like for the viewers, how it should be viewed.

What's more, you know how the "enough" Qi Min said when Qian Qian started eating from the floor had completely different feeling to it than in usual "toxic romance". Usually the "enough" would indicate that he wants her to stop, because he is actually horrified of what he made her do, it would shock him how much he broke her. But here the "enough" was just an indicator he is pleased with what he achieved, he is glad to see her this broken, that he achieved what he wanted and has her where he wanted.

That said, he is a psycho, but he is really a broken psycho (compared to his younger brother who is just a psycho, period, no more adjectives to use). He does have tears in the eyes. I am sure he would be willing to kill the child, but this whole situation and the rejection does not only make him angry (and oh boy it makes he so angry), but also kind of scared and hopeless. He is obsessed with creating "family" with her, to the point he actually feels scared of not being able to do that. And that's how the "so scared of losing her, so obsessed, he is willing to do anything" truly would look like.

I love how there is no vagueness in this relationship and how it's portrayed. There is no hope, no passion, no desire, no love. Just obsession and fear.

On Pursuit of Jade Mar 8, 2026
9 episodes in, the quality of production and the beauty of aesthetics still surprises me 😭

You know what I enjoy this drama?
Many things πŸ˜‚

I love how the vague themes are well known "cliches", but the details is what makes it more interesting. We get the structure of the genre that we enjoy, but also some refreshing presentation.

Female lead not being either delicate wallflower, nor crossdressing tomboy. She faced many setbacks and tragedies, but her life is not trauma porn, she does have a great social support system around her.

Male lead is neither this completely cold lead manhandling FL, nor the pushover trampled by "strong female lead". He plays his game well, strategically, but also lets his emotion lead him when needed. He uses both his brain and his heart.

The second male lead scholar is not this self-rightious weak annoying asshole who cannot even be taken seriously as a second male lead. While not as "cool" as male lead, he still commands the attention when he is on screen and honestly could be a valid option (btw, I am not even completely sure Li will be the typical second male lead lol)

Up till now the little sister was not shown as obstacle and prop to cause troubles and create external issues (like constantly being in danger etc.). She is fun and well rounded character and that's humor and heart to the story.

Even though not much, I also love Yu Qian Qian. She is for sure Girl's girl and that's great. Cannot wait for her friendship with female lead.

For the plot itself - I love the slow pace in how the story is unfolding. We barely started to get scenes about the court politics and the whole "big picture of the schemes". We still do not really understand the complexity of the fractions struggles for power, who is on whose side and why. They are still slowly introduce characters. And that's great. Coz I have time to process what I am watching. I'm not bombarded with 487568496 characters, I get to know 2-3, and the we get a few new ones. I love how slowly the are expanding the world.

The fighting scenes? Fuck yeah. Also, the fact we do get as many if not more scenes of female lead fighting over male lead? Fuck yeah. Why is this more like Legend of the Female General than Legend of the Female General? 🀑 And the choreographies are actually good. The filming hides the stunt double well, and they are doing a decent job with wire work. Also, blood looks like blood. And wounds heal in a proper manner and length. Ain't no one getting slashed and stabbed and being fine 30 minutes later.
